/*
* Check for mixed case usernames, meaning probably hacked. Jon2 3-94
* Summary of rules now implemented in this patch: Ensor 11-94
* In a mixed-case name, if first char is upper, one more upper may
* appear anywhere. (A mixed-case name *must* have an upper first
* char, and may have one other upper.)
* A third upper may appear if all 3 appear at the beginning of the
* name, separated only by "others" (-/_/.).
* A single group of digits is allowed anywhere.
* Two groups of digits are allowed if at least one of the groups is
* at the beginning or the end.
* Only one '-', '_', or '.' is allowed (or two, if not consecutive).
* But not as the first or last char.
* No other special characters are allowed.
* Name must contain at least one letter.
*/
